Rationale"The Internet and other forms of information and communication technology (ICT) such as word processors, Web editors, presentation software, and e-mail are regularly redefining the nature of literacy." from the IRA's Position Statement: Integrating Technology and Literacy into the Curriculum found online at: http://www.ira.org/positions/technology.html PurposeThe purpose of this site is to provide K-2 educators in the Cedar Rapids Community School District with resources for integrating technology in the curriculum. Also, this site should support teachers in meeting the following International Reading Association Professional standards: 5.7.
Use instructional and information technologies to support literacy
learning. 8.1. Provide opportunities to locate and use a variety of print, nonprint, and electronic reference sources. 12.4. Select and evaluate instructional materials for literacy, including those that are technology –based Suggestions may be sent to Ann Nicholson, Curriculum Technology Specialist for the Cedar Rapids district. |
